Automobile companies have released the sales figures for the month of February. The country’s largest automaker Maruti Suzuki has registered an increase in sales in February. At the same time, Tata Motors, the second largest automaker, continued to dominate in February as well. While Toyota Kirloskar has registered a decline of 38 percent in sales in February. sales of maruti suzuki increased
Maruti Suzuki on Tuesday announced that it sold a total of 164,056 cars in February. The carmaker also said that it recorded the highest ever monthly sales last month with 24,021 units. India’s largest carmaker also claimed that it sold a total of 137,607 units in the domestic market last month. Maruti Suzuki has also said that its total domestic passenger vehicle (PAV) sales in February stood at 1,33,948 units as against 1,44,761 units in the same month a year ago.
Tata Motors sales up 27%
Tata Motors sold 73,875 units domestically in February, registering a 27 per cent increase in annual sales rate. The company had sold 58,366 units in February 2021. Tata Motors said sales of passenger vehicles in the domestic market last month grew by 47 per cent to 39,981 units as against 27,225 units in the same month last year. Total domestic commercial vehicle sales increased by 9 per cent to 33,894 units as against 31,141 units in the year-ago period.
Mahindra Sales Figures
Mahindra’s auto segment posted total sales of 54,455 units in February, a growth of 16.34 per cent over the previous month. The company says that due to the chip shortage, car sales also increased by 38.56% to 27,663 units compared to January. According to Vijay Nakra, Chief Executive, Automotive Division, strong demand was witnessed across all segments including SUVs, which registered the highest ever monthly sales. However, there was a decline in agriculture segment sales. Tractor sales stood at 20,437 units in February, down 9.8 per cent over the previous month.
